  "account": "Listen Labs, an AI research startup specializing in voice AI for customer interviews, had a term sheet for a $125 million Series C round at a $1.5 billion valuation, led by Menlo Ventures, fail to close. This is an uncommon occurrence in the venture world, usually frowned upon by venture capitalists (VCs). The financing likely fell through due to ongoing acquisition talks with Salesforce, a CRM giant that reportedly wants to purchase Listen Labs for approximately $2 billion, per Business Insider. Although these discussions are still pending, a deal may not materialize. Listen Labs, a three-year-old startup, generates about $30 million in annualized revenue, roughly three times that of its competitor Simile, which recently secured a $200 million Series B at a $2 billion valuation led by Greenoaks. If the Salesforce deal falls through, VCs anticipate Listen Labs will return to the market, aiming for a valuation of $2 billion or higher. While purchasing Listen Labs could enhance Salesforce's AI capabilities by leveraging its technology to anticipate customer needs, Salesforce might deem the $67 times revenue multiple too high. Listen Labs was co-founded in 2023 by Florian Jüngermann, a former German competitive computer programming champion, and Alfred Wahlforss, who previously co-founded staffing startup Bemlo. The duo met during their master's degrees at Harvard. Utilizing AI, Listen Labs develops survey questions and conducts customer interviews through audio or video, transforming the data into reports and PowerPoint presentations akin to those produced by human market researchers. Fortune 500 companies leverage this technology to understand customer needs and satisfaction rapidly. Competitors to Listen Labs in this space include Outset, Keplar, and Aaru, with some automating interviews with real humans and others, like Aaru and Simile, employing a synthetic approach by using AI to predict responses without actual human interviews.",
